SIT to Investigate ghee Adulteration in tirupati Laddoos
The andhra pradesh government has officially established a nine-member Special Investigation Team (SIT) to investigate allegations of ghee adulteration in the famous tirumala tirupati Devasthanam (TTD) temple's Laddu prasadam. The SIT will be led by guntur Range Inspector General of police Sarvashresth Tripathi and includes key officers such as Visakhapatnam Range DIG Gopinath Jatti and kadapa SP v Harshavardhan Raju.

The team is tasked with conducting a thorough investigation into claims of adulterated ghee used in the preparation of the tirupati Laddoos during the previous government led by jagan mohan reddy, based on an FIR filed at the tirupati East police station. According to the government order, the SIT may request information and assistance from any government department and is encouraged to seek external expert help as necessary.

Background of the Controversy
The issue gained traction when andhra pradesh chief minister Chandrababu Naidu alleged that substandard ingredients, including animal fat, were found in the Laddu prasadam during Reddy's administration. The ruling telugu desam party (TDP) claimed that a Gujarat-based livestock laboratory confirmed the adulteration of ghee samples provided by TTD.

Jagan Mohan Reddy's Response
Former chief minister jagan mohan reddy strongly refuted the allegations, accusing Naidu of politicizing the issue. He labeled Naidu a "pathological and habitual liar," and during a press conference on september 20, he emphasized that the alleged lab report concerning animal fat and beef oil pertains to a time when Naidu was in power. reddy described the charges against him and his administration as "false" and "unnecessary," asserting that the controversy is unwarranted.
